L1022: Write-Up Instructions and Marking Scheme for the Project 2024-25

Please read this document carefully – it explains how you should write up your project report and how many points you can score for different sections. You should use this document in combination with the “Project Analysis Instructions” document.

The “Project Analysis Instructions” document contains instructions on the analysis you should perform on the data. You have received your dataset via email. The datasets are different across students, and you need to use the one you were sent.

Once you have opened your data in Excel, perform the analysis as stated in each question in the “Project Analysis Instructions” document. (You can use another software if you are more comfortable with it.) Then write up your results in a word document and copy in your tables and graphs from Excel. (In the end, you need to submit one Word or PDF document. Do NOT submit an Excel file with your calculations.)

5% of the marks will be given for the general presentation of the report. To achieve these marks, make sure your report has:

A clear coherent structure (using sub-headings where appropriate)

Clear, concise writing that is easy to understand

Numbered tables and graphs with clear headings

Coherent formatting. (There are no particular rules for the formatting; it just has to be reasonable and consistent throughout.)

The suggested general format for writing up the project and marks available for each section is as follows:

Give your project a title and begin with a short introduction summarising your project. Define your variables and identify the questions you will address using the provided data. Use academic literature to give background information on the topic. You only need to provide a handful of sources here, but make sure you cite them correctly. [10%]

Descriptive statistics (question 1): Describe the data, using summary statistics and graphs, as appropriate. Provide a well-formatted table showing descriptive statistics for all variables and discuss them in the text. Use at least four graphs to show important or interesting features of the data. Make sure your graphs are properly formatted. Provide a written interpretation of each graph. [15%]

Correlations (question 2): find the correlation coefficients, test their statistical significance, and comment on the results. Write out the full test procedure for the first hypothesis test (no need to repeat the full test procedure for the second test). Provide an interpretation of your results. [10%]

Correlations (question 3): find the correlation coefficients and interpret them. You do not need to test their statistical significance. [5%]

Test whether countries that impose legal restrictions on women’s ability to work have higher adolescent fertility rates (question 4): make sure you clearly write out all steps of the hypothesis test and interpret your results. [10%]

Simple linear regression (question 5): Show your regression results and interpret the intercept and slope coefficients. Write out the hypothesis test for statistical significance of the slope coefficient. Comment on your results. [10%]

Multiple linear regression (question 6): Show your regression results and interpret the regression coefficients. Comment on the economic and statistical significance of all the slope coefficients. (You do not need to write out the hypothesis tests here, just state the results.) [5%]

R-squared (question 7): Interpret the R-squared and make sure you clearly write out all steps of the hypothesis test and interpret your results. [10%]

Multiple linear regression (question 9): Show your regression results and interpret the regression coefficients. Comment on the economic and statistical significance of all the slope coefficients. (You do not need to write out the hypothesis tests here, just state the results.) [5%]

Comparing regression models (question 10): Explain which of the regression models fits the data best. How do you decide? And why do you think this particular model happens to work best? [5%]

Prediction (question 11): Make sure you write out the regression equation, show and interpret your result. [5%]

Conclusions. What are the overall findings of the project? How does this relate to the literature you discussed in the introduction? Are there potential policy implications? [5%]
